Can a Stuffy Nose Cause You to Snore?

A stuffy nose can cause or significantly worsen snoring. This occurs because nasal congestion, which is the swelling of nasal tissues that restricts airflow, forces a person to breathe through their mouth while sleeping. Snoring is the rattling sound produced by the vibration of soft tissues in the back of the throat. When the primary breathing pathway through the nose is blocked, switching to oral breathing alters airflow dynamics and triggers these vibrations.

The Physics of Nasal Obstruction and Snoring

The nose is designed to be the main channel for respiration, allowing for smooth, quiet airflow. When nasal passages are obstructed, the body shifts to mandatory mouth breathing during sleep to draw in enough oxygen. This change is disadvantageous because the air stream is no longer filtered or slowed by the nasal cavity.

The forced intake of air through the mouth creates a high-velocity, turbulent flow directly into the back of the throat. This turbulent air causes the soft tissues, specifically the soft palate and the uvula, to flutter rapidly. Increased negative pressure, or suction force, is generated when air is forcefully inhaled to compensate for the blocked nose. This suction destabilizes the throat tissues, increasing their collapse and vibration, which causes the snoring sound.

Common Sources of Congestion Leading to Snoring

Nasal congestion that leads to snoring stems from two categories: acute, temporary conditions and chronic, structural issues. Acute causes involve the temporary swelling of the nasal lining, often due to inflammation or infection. Common examples include the common cold or flu, acute sinusitis, and seasonal or environmental allergies. Snoring often resolves once the underlying illness or allergic reaction clears.

Structural or chronic issues involve a persistent physical blockage of the nasal airway. These may include a deviated septum, nasal polyps, or enlarged turbinates. These issues require consistent management or medical intervention because they structurally impede the normal flow of air.

Immediate Strategies for Relief

Several accessible, non-prescription remedies can alleviate nighttime nasal congestion and potentially reduce associated snoring. One simple change involves altering your sleeping posture to encourage better sinus drainage. Elevating the head of the bed using extra pillows or a foam wedge helps reduce congestion by working with gravity.

Increasing the humidity in the bedroom environment can soothe irritated nasal passages and thin out thick mucus. Using a cool-mist humidifier throughout the night keeps the nasal membranes moist, making it easier to breathe through the nose. Taking a steamy shower before bed achieves a similar temporary decongestant effect.

Applying external nasal dilator strips is a mechanical solution that physically opens the nasal passages. These flexible bands adhere to the bridge of the nose and gently pull the nostrils outward, increasing the nasal airway area. A saline nasal spray or rinse can also be used before sleep to flush out mucus and irritants.

Controlling the bedroom environment by minimizing common allergens is an important strategy for chronic congestion sufferers. Regular cleaning to reduce dust mites and keeping pets out of the sleeping area can prevent the nasal inflammation that triggers nighttime congestion. If severe, persistent snoring continues despite these measures, especially if accompanied by gasping or pauses in breathing, consult a healthcare professional to rule out conditions like sleep apnea.
